Service staff to double in the next four months
December 27, 2010 | By Kiran Hooda
On a pleasant and sunny December day we catch up with Anil Bhatia, the recently appointed managing director of manroland India at the company’s office in New Delhi. manroland is looking forward to a good 2011 as the company is quite optimistic on the demand in this market. “We will have the biggest year in the history of manroland’s India operations. Next year we will install the maximum number of presses that we have ever installed in a year in India,” says Bhatia a mechanical engineer, who was earlier involved in the construction equipment manufacturing industry. Bhatia speaks not just of the newspaper web offset market where the company has traditionally been the leader in supplying high-speed 4 x 2 and 4 x 1 presses, but also of the sheetfed offset market where there is already a commitment for six presses in the coming year, with hopes to move even further. ...cont´d
